Complete Buying Guide for Hyundai Santa Fe Brake Pads

Essential Factors We Consider

When selecting brake pads for your Hyundai Santa Fe, several key factors determine performance and longevity. First, consider the material type – ceramic pads offer quiet operation and clean wheels, while metallic pads provide more aggressive stopping power. Fitment is crucial, so always verify compatibility with your specific Santa Fe model and year. Heat resistance and fade performance matter for both daily driving and occasional spirited driving. Finally, consider your budget while understanding that premium materials typically offer better longevity and performance.

Budget Planning

Brake pad costs can vary significantly based on quality and quantity. Budget options typically range from $20-40 for individual pads, while premium ceramic sets can cost $60-100. Complete brake pad kits (front and rear) usually range from $80-150 depending on quality and brand. Remember to factor in labor costs if you’re not doing the installation yourself. While it’s tempting to choose the cheapest option, investing in quality brake pads often saves money in the long run by lasting longer and providing better performance.

Frequently Asked Questions

Q: How often should I replace brake pads on my Hyundai Santa Fe?

A: Brake pad replacement intervals vary depending on driving habits, but most Hyundai Santa Fe models require brake pad replacement every 30,000 to 70,000 miles. Regular inspection every 12,000 miles or during oil changes is recommended to catch wear early.

Q: Can I install brake pads myself on my Hyundai Santa Fe?

A: Yes, brake pad replacement is a DIY-friendly job that most car enthusiasts can handle with basic tools. However, proper torque specifications and brake fluid handling are important for safety. If you’re not comfortable working on brakes, consult a professional mechanic.

Q: What’s the difference between ceramic and metallic brake pads?

A: Ceramic brake pads are quieter, produce less dust, and offer smooth braking performance ideal for daily driving. Metallic pads provide more aggressive stopping power and heat resistance, making them better for performance driving or towing.

Q: Do I need to replace both front and rear brake pads at the same time?

A: While not always required, replacing brake pads on both axles simultaneously is recommended for balanced braking performance. Uneven pad wear can affect vehicle handling and safety.

Q: How can I tell if my Hyundai Santa Fe brake pads need replacement?

A: Signs that your brake pads need replacement include squealing or grinding noises when braking, reduced braking performance, longer stopping distances, or visual inspection showing pad thickness below 3mm. Some vehicles have wear indicators that produce a high-pitched sound when pads are worn down.
